The cheapest way to get from Gangi to Castelbuono is to bus which costs €3 - €5 and takes 1h 2m.
The fastest way to get from Gangi to Castelbuono is to drive which takes 38 min and costs €5 - €9.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Gangi and arriving at Castelbuono. Services depart twice daily,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 1h 2m.
The distance between Gangi and Castelbuono is 36 km. The road distance is 36 km.
The best way to get from Gangi to Castelbuono without a car is to bus which takes 1h 2m and costs €3 - €5.
The bus from Gangi to Castelbuono takes 1h 2m including transfers and departs twice daily.
Gangi to Castelbuono bus services, operated by SAIS trasporti S.p.A. - Autolinee Giamporcaro, depart from Gangi station.
Gangi to Castelbuono bus services, operated by SAIS trasporti S.p.A. - Autolinee Giamporcaro, arrive at Castelbuono station.
Yes, the driving distance between Gangi to Castelbuono is 36 km. It takes approximately 38 min to drive from Gangi to Castelbuono.
